Endoscopic Brow Lift

The endoscopic browlift in Gander will help you achieve an improved, youthful appearance. This type of browlift is minimally invasive, and requires small incisions to be made in the scalp in order to insert a tube with a small camera. The camera lets the doctor see the underlying tissue and muscles.

Your surgeon can then make the necessary adjustments on the brows in order to achieve a more defined and lifted appearance. The endoscopic browlift has a quicker recovery than traditional browlifts. It typically takes about a week for any swelling or bruising to subside.

During the recovery period, you may be asked to wear a headband to reduce swelling. The results of endoscopically performed browlifts can last as long as 10 years depending on your lifestyle, age, and health.

Coronal Brow Lift

Another option for brow lift surgery in Gander is the coronal brow lift. This type of browlift surgery is performed using an incision on the top of your scalp. The underlying muscles and tissues are then repositioned, and the skin is re-draped over to give the brow a more youthful and attractive appearance.

The coronal browlift is a better alternative to the direct browlift. It can give a more natural appearance and provide a lasting result. The incision, which is located in the hairline of the patient, is often well-hidden. The coronal browlift can also be combined with other procedures such as eyelid or facelift surgery.

As the incision is healed, the recovery time for the coronal browlift will be longer than that of a direct browlift. You can minimize this by following your surgeon’s post-operative directions. After the procedure, swelling or bruising is common and lasts for two weeks. Some people may feel numbness and tightness on the forehead. This should go away over time. Your surgeon will probably tell you to keep the head elevated in order to reduce swelling.

What to Expect During Your Brow Lift

An anesthetic is administered before the brow-lift procedure. You will remain comfortable and relaxed through the entire procedure.

Your surgeon will then make the necessary incisions on the upper forehead area once the anesthetic is in place. Incisions made to the upper forehead may be concealed in the hairline.

The soft tissues will be repositioned and the muscles tightened by your surgeon to achieve a more youthful look. Finally, excess skin will then be removed. Incisions will then be closed with adhesive strips or stitches.

You will most likely experience some swelling or bruising following your procedure. This should subside in the first few days. Some tenderness may occur in the area treated, but can be easily controlled with cold compressions and over-the counter pain medication.

About Gander, Newfoundland and Labrador A1V

Gander is a town located in the northeastern portion of the island of Newfoundland in the Canadian province of Newfoundland and Labrador, approximately 40 km (25 mi) south of Gander Bay, 100 km (62 mi) south of Twillingate and 90 km (56 mi) east of Grand Falls-Windsor. Located upon the northeastern shore of Gander Lake, it is the site of Gander International Airport, once an important refuelling End for transatlantic aircraft.
